Output 59e80bf38f94536d1e168699f132877fd1f790a3e8aaf13b9017c75a14cd3ab8:4

value
190882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3311411813a7650d84bf51862656b0d8b9e65bd6 OP_EQUALVERIFY OP_CHECKSIG
address
15f28dchKgTNxpcsum3663EXsVgYLeK7Dy
transaction
59e80bf38f94536d1e168699f132877fd1f790a3e8aaf13b9017c75a14cd3ab8
spent
true